Basic Concepts of V Ribbed Belts
V Ribbed Belts are characterized by their trapezoidal cross-section, which allows them to transmit power efficiently between the engine’s rotating components 1. These belts are constructed from multiple layers of rubber and fabric, providing both flexibility and strength. In a truck’s engine system, V Ribbed Belts drive various components such as the alternator, water pump, and air conditioning compressor, ensuring these systems operate smoothly and efficiently.

Maintenance Tips
To ensure the 3687540 V Ribbed Belt operates at peak efficiency, regular maintenance is recommended. Inspect the belt at routine intervals for signs of wear, such as cracks, fraying, or glazing. Check the tension to ensure it meets the manufacturer’s specifications, as both over-tightening and under-tightening can lead to premature wear. Keeping the belt clean and free from contaminants will also contribute to its longevity.
Troubleshooting Common Issues
Common issues with the 3687540 V Ribbed Belt include slippage, cracks, and excessive wear. Slippage may indicate incorrect tension or contamination on the belt’s surface, requiring adjustment or cleaning. Cracks or fraying suggest the belt has reached the end of its service life and should be replaced. Excessive wear can be mitigated by ensuring proper tension and alignment, and by addressing any underlying issues with the driven components.

Role of Part 3687540 V Ribbed Belt in Engine Systems
The part 3687540 V Ribbed Belt is integral to the efficient operation of various engine components. It serves as the primary means of transferring rotational force from the engine’s crankshaft to auxiliary components.
Drive System Integration
In the drive system, the V Ribbed Belt connects the crankshaft to the water pump, ensuring consistent coolant circulation. This circulation is essential for maintaining optimal engine temperature 3. Additionally, the belt drives the alternator, which charges the battery and powers the electrical systems while the engine is running. The precision of the V Ribbed Belt’s fit and the tension it maintains are key to the reliable operation of these driven components.
Fan Operation
The V Ribbed Belt also plays a significant role in the operation of the engine’s cooling fan. By transferring power from the crankshaft to the fan, it ensures that air is consistently drawn through the radiator, aiding in the dissipation of heat. This is particularly important under high-load conditions or in traffic where the natural airflow is reduced. The efficient transfer of power by the V Ribbed Belt helps maintain the fan’s speed and, consequently, the engine’s temperature within safe operating ranges.
